Output 5251b03f8a58ba6dcda326c7d64118d51998478c6bbfcbdd9fd91129e5b999ba:0

value
201778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c320fbc21d2fbc261cdb392d59265fb96d42d07 OP_EQUAL
address
3EUJVjP9p2gmPfxhn8TuXKJYLVJMg1PwWA
transaction
5251b03f8a58ba6dcda326c7d64118d51998478c6bbfcbdd9fd91129e5b999ba
confirmations
331147
spent
true